How does it Work?
• The mirror allows the viewer to see through the lens.
• Light is bounced from a mirror through a pentaprism to the viewer's eye while choosing the object for photography.
• The shutter button lifts the viewing mirror while opening the shutter to allow the light to fall on the film...

Why Do you Want to Know?
Quality ImprovementSearches for ways to improve an existing product.
Comparison of new Pentax MX (top) and old K1000 (bottom)Image borrowed from slimmer_jimmerhttps://www.flickr.com/photos/slimjim/
Pure UnderstandingAttempts to obtain an in-depth understanding of a product for intellectual purposes.
Cost Reduction Evaluates the product and/or manufacturing methods in search of cost savings.Benchmarking Is often useful for comparing a group of products in a detailed manner.Evaluating CompetitorsExamine patent violation , analyze the product for cloning , design modification.

Why you may want to know how the learning environment works?
Quality ImprovementWe have been teaching one course for some time. We are able to tell the impact of the course and find ways of improvement.Pure UnderstandingSomebody else taught this course in the past. We would like to gain understanding. Or you know this course works well and you would like to apply it to other courses. Or your are planning to change learning solution.Cost Reduction Can we improve the efficiency of the course? Time required? Delivery methods?
Evaluating CompetitorsSomebody else is teaching a similar course. How do they do it? Is it better?And more…
